Learning and Skills Development Agency
I'm the Regional Director for the North at the Learning and Skills Development Agency , one of a team of nine.
My office is in Newcastle Upon Tyne, at the International Centre for Life.
The Learning and Skills Development Agency is a strategic national resource for the development of policy and practice in post-16 education and training. The Agency was previously known as the Further Education Development Agency (FEDA).
Speaking in Chapel Hill, North Carolina 1998Before returning to the North East in 1999, I was FEDA's Head of Regional and Economic Development, based in London, having joined the agency in 1996 from a senior post at Kent TEC. Prior to this I worked for the London Docklands Development Corporation and in the voluntary sector in London and the North East. I began my working career with Scottish and Newcastle Breweries.I'm also a Fellow of the Royal Society of Arts (FRSA) and a Member of the Institute of Management ( MIMgt)
